Understanding Ceramic Filter Membranes: Key Insights for Industrial Filtration

Ceramic filter membranes are advanced materials used in the process of separating particles from liquids or gases. These membranes are composed primarily of inorganic materials, which give them exceptional thermal stability and chemical resistance. Unlike polymer membranes, ceramic membranes are less prone to degradation and can operate effectively in extreme conditions, making them ideal for industrial settings.
One of the key advantages of ceramic filter membranes is their high permeability and selectivity. They can be engineered to have precise pore sizes, allowing for the efficient removal of specific contaminants while permitting the flow of desired substances. This property is particularly beneficial in applications such as wastewater treatment, food and beverage processing, and pharmaceutical manufacturing, where the purity and quality of the end product are paramount.
In addition to their superior filtration capabilities, ceramic filter membranes also boast a longer service life compared to conventional filters. Their resistance to fouling and scaling reduces maintenance frequency and costs, making them a cost-effective solution in the long run. Furthermore, the ability to clean ceramic membranes using various methods, including backwashing and chemical cleaning, enhances their longevity and performance.
The manufacturing process of ceramic filter membranes involves advanced techniques such as sintering and extrusion, which contribute to their structural integrity and performance. These membranes can be tailored to specific applications by adjusting factors such as pore size, thickness, and surface properties. This customization allows industries to optimize their filtration processes, resulting in improved efficiency and product quality.
Ceramic filter membranes are increasingly being used in various sectors, including water treatment, where they remove suspended solids, bacteria, and viruses, ensuring clean and safe drinking water. In the food and beverage industry, they are utilized for processes like juice clarification and beer filtration, enhancing product clarity and stability. Additionally, in the pharmaceutical field, ceramic membranes are critical for sterilizing solutions and ensuring the safety of medicinal products.
In conclusion, ceramic filter membranes represent a significant advancement in filtration technology. Their unique properties and advantages make them an excellent choice for a wide range of industrial applications. By understanding the benefits and applications of ceramic filter membranes, professionals can make informed decisions that enhance operational efficiency and product quality in their respective fields.
